Finance is full of such hidden risks. Start a fund, take insane risks, maybe generate outsize returns ⇒ profit by growing funds under management and take a % of that.
If not, try, try again. Google “incubator funds”. Taleb’s Fooled by Randomness has many examples.
But if you are taking risks, won’t people see it and shun you? Probably not. It is very hard to see risk after the event. It is not too hard to “stuff the risk into the tails”. There are even conslutants who will help you do this.
Even without cheating, when a test is very stringent, then an alarming fraction of the apparent top performers may have just had a lucky day.
